    I've seen this mentioned before, but unless you are specific with the topics it cannot be answered.

    Finance, ie PV calculations are a branch of finance, not of accounting, so the more likely scenario is that there were BEC questions on FAR. I know this because I am studying FAR, and accountants need to know finance to record some items.

    Likewise with ratios, capital, equity vs debt, depreciation methods, tax effects, etc.

    When they are applied to studying profitability or business success they are BEC.

    I don't remember where I read it (maybe Becker review course?), but I do remember reading that for the BEC writing portion, they may have questions relating to other topics than BEC until they get enough questions developed since the writing portion is still fairly new. Becker emphasized that you need to focus on clarity, organization, professionalism, and tone of your thoughts more than actually having a “correct” answer. I got several FAR/AUD type questions on my BEC, and totally know my facts were probably not 100% on, but I passed, so focus more on your writing content (using paragraphs, introductory words, correct punctuation & spelling) and not so much your writing content (don't write about pandas, but you know what I mean) and that is what you are graded on.

    Just as MOD said a lot of sections in BEC relate to FAR: capital management, NPV, fin. risk mgt (questions like how would distributing 500 shares of common stock effect EPS vs. issuing 20,000 of debt) , just as a lot of the questions regarding corporate governance are considered “AUD” questions, and almost any cash flow is going to have a tax component to it. I haven't sat for BEC yet but I have noticed overlaps in all of the sections, the more overlapping material the better in my opinion.
